I have another question about Microsoft's Visual Basic 2008 Express Edition?
What .NET Framework do I need in order to run my Web Browser Program I made with Microsoft's Visual Basic 2008 Express Edition...
a. MS .Net Framework 1.1 (x86)
b. MS .Net Framework 3.0 (x86)
c. MS .Net Framework 2.0 (x86)
d. Other MS .Net Framework
What about if I have Vista, and wanted to run my program on a Vista Machine, would my program work on Vista...?
What .Net Framework do I need in order to run my program on Vista...?
.NET 2.0 (x64)....?

What Framework did you compile your program against? (Pauses.......) You just answered your own question. Did you actually just create a "Web Browser Program" with the Express Edition of VB 2008? I'm not sure what that means since you would use Visual Web Developer 2008 Express to create ASP .NET applications.....but if you did, then checking the property pages of your project would help. I'm sure the 2008 Express Editions has Framework targeting, so you can install against any of the .NET Frameworks you have installed.
If you are running Vista, you have 2.0 and 3.0 installed already. This page might help you with some other questions you may still have:

Vista comes by default with .NET3.0, but it's better if you install .NET3.5
If you installed your visual basc 2008 , then you already have 3.5 cause that's how it works. Just target you application to 3.5, it's latest and has really good options with it
